Rotary Barn open until Dec. 13
Yes, The Rotary Club Barn is still open every Saturday from 8:30 to 11 a.m. till Dec. 13. The money raised at the Rotary Club Barn goes back to our community in the form of scholarships, donations to organizations like the Boothbay Region Food Pantry, Boothbay V.E.T.S. project, the High School Rotary Interact Club, the Boothbay Community Resource Council and so much more.
It also supports the Rotary Bike Project, where we loan almost 100 bikes out to our seasonal workers providing a way for them to get to their jobs. Currently we have four bikes that haven't been returned from this season. Please drop them off or call for a pick up.
